Starting August 15, Colombian citizens entering Poland to perform work will be required to have a visa. The exception to the visa requirement exemption is introduced based on Article 3(2) of the Agreement between the European Union and the Republic of Colombia concerning the abolition of short-stay visas, drawn up in Brussels on December 2, 2015, in conjunction with Article 6(3) of the aforementioned Regulation (EU) 2018/1806 of the European Parliament and of the Council.

Simultaneously, Colombian citizens coming to Poland for tourism purposes are exempt from the visa requirement and may stay in Poland, on the basis of a passport, for a period of no more than 90 days in a 180-day period.
